[Review] 6858 Lego Super Heroes: Catwoman Catcycle Chase
Set Details
Theme: Super Heroes
Set Name: Catwoman Catcycle City Chase
Number of pieces: 89
Number of Bags: 2
Number of free-floating pieces: 1
Instruction Manuals: 1
MSRP: $12.99 USA | $15.99 Canada | £11.99 UK
Price Per Piece: $0.146 USA | $0.180 Canada | £0.135 UK

Here's a sample of the instruction booklet. If you look close enough the round 2x2
plate in step 6 disappears in step 7 only to reappear in step 8. I went ahead and
removed/replaced it-but I really didn't see the point. The instructions also seem to
have been rushed. Mottling and distortion appear throughout and the distortion gets
worse toward the end. Comic and cover images are fine- this is just in the
instructions.



This! This is what I like to see. Pre-printed newspaper tiles that look and read like the
real thing. (barely-get a magnifying glass) These look very nice and would
complement a bunch of MOCS.

The idea of the set is that Catwoman steals a diamond and races away while
Batman severs a streetlight to crush her spirit and escape attempt. The playability of
this set is very good. Here are some pictures of what happens:

Build: 4/5
Simple and straightforward. Nice use of bricks for a mailbox.
Minifigures: 5/5
2 minifigures, one exclusive to this set and the other Batman-very nice
Pieces: 3/5
If you look at the hanging streetlight- there's 15 of the pieces right there. While there
are some unique and fun pieces-this isn't a set you're going to buy for parts.
Price: 3/5
Find this one on sale, clip a coupon, or use a gift card. Saving at least 3 dollars will
bring this set down to what I would pay for it.
Play Features: 5/5
Very fun set. Get ready to make swooshing noises as the batarang topples the light
and revving engine noises for Catwoman, and jetpack noises for Batman. Actually,
just make sure you're not parched before you build this set. Have a glass of water
handy.
Overall: 4/5
All in all, I'm happy with my purchase. If you can find this set on discount or have a
giftcard collecting dust somewhere you could do a whole lot worse than this set.
